Badge 373
Los Angeles: Paramount Pictures, 1973. Three vintage studio still photographs from the 1973 film. Each photograph with printed mimeo snipe affixed to the verso and one provenance stamp on the verso.
A gritty crime thriller about a racist Irish cop who is forced to turn in his badge after killing a Puerto Rican suspect while in pursuit of the man that killed his former partner. The second film based on the experiences of real-life New York policeman Eddie Egan, following William Friedkin's 1971 film "The French Connection" two years prior.
Set and shot on location in New York.
8 x 10 inches. Very Good plus.
